Editorial overview Touché

Liberation by Corinna Turner, published by Unseen Books in 2015, is a compelling narrative that explores the struggles against a dystopian regime. This edition spans 324 pages and is presented in English. The story follows Margo, Bane, and Jon as they confront the oppressive EuroGov, determined to rescue fellow ReAssignees and challenge the system that threatens their future.

Readers will find a blend of action, adventure, and themes of love and resilience woven throughout the plot. As Margo prepares for her marriage to Bane, the stakes rise when their secret base is discovered, prompting a fierce response from the EuroGov. The narrative delves into the complexities of fighting for freedom and the personal sacrifices involved, set against a backdrop of a society grappling with control and rebellion.


Official synopsis Publisher

“Seriously, Bane, should I sit around and pat myself on the back for resisting the EuroGov for six months of my life and call it a day? Or should I go out and try to make a world in which you and I can raise children without being afraid one day they’ll be taken from us and murdered?” SALPERTON FACILITY STANDS EMPTY – EVERY OTHER FACILITY IS FULL. TIME TO DO SOMETHING ABOUT IT. Margo, Bane and Jon are determined to fight the EuroGov. Preferably by rescuing as many other ReAssignees as possible. And if doing so shakes the EuroBloc to its foundations, so much the better. Meanwhile – a madman awaits his fate. The world waits for Margo to take up her pen again. And in their secret base, Margo and Bane prepare to marry at last. But the safety of their new home is deceptive. When they are discovered, the EuroGov’s vengeance will be swift. And merciless.
